Getbent
09-27-2011, 07:03 PM
Brought home a dozen of both spruce and ruffed.
Ate another half dozen in camp, actually had some wseet shootouts, buddy with the 410 and me with the trusty old single shot cooey. must say the cooey was bang on.
Actually ran into a couple of mixed coveys, something I havent seen for awhile.
Also, the last couple of coveys were tiny compared to some of the birds so must have been a 2nd hatch. One set was stuffed full of grasshoppers which was pretty cool.
We were also on the chase one sunny afternoon on a real spooky covey of ruffed that were running all over. Momma started calling them and they were running everywhere, picked a couple off as we ran back n forth from both sides of the road...as we drove away they were still running back n forth it was pretty funny.

Str8shooterbc
12-04-2011, 10:55 PM
Wife & I hunted hard October & November. Grand Forks (North Fork Granby River) to Jewel Lake for 4 days - seen 10 or 15 - shot 2.

4 days hunting Christian Valley, Beverdell and Big White to Kelowna - a lot of FSRs. less that 5 seen, none shot.

1 day around Hope-Princeton near Princeton with a dog. Didn't bounce a single grouse

5 days total out of Qualicum Beach didn't see 1 grouse.

All these areas have been good grouse areas in the past. This is worse than last year and last year was what I thought was the worst I ever experienced. I sure hope we get a good Spring in 2012 favorable to the chicks. 2009 was a bumper year.

Sure did see a lot of coyotes though.
